Description

Explore the rich history of Lower Manhattan through its spooky past. Visit the grounds where the spirits of soldiers still remain vigilant. Feel the chills at the graveyards of departed souls who may still walk the grounds. Learn why Ellis Island may be haunted by restless spirits. Uncover the truth of New York's most beloved ghost, Chloe.

Mississippi Sightseeing Cruise

The sightseeing cruise is a 90-minute tour that takes you down the Mighty Mississippi with live historical commentary. This is a great way to see and learn a bit of Mississippi River history while visiting Memphis, Tennessee. Snacks, drinks and alcohol are available on board, as well as restrooms. No outside food or drinks allowed.

San Antonio Market Square Tex-Mex Food and Shopping Tour

Experience the best Tex-Mex in San Antonio in the place where Tex-Mex was invented. Shop the largest Mexican market in the United States with over 30 vendors! Listen to authentic mariachi music at Mi Tierra Cafe. Eat at La Margarita, birthplace of the fajita, and enjoy $5 margaritas all day. Hear the fascinating stories of the Chili Queens who introduced America to Texas chili con carne in the 1860s.
